NEWS / Pennsylvania Democrats propose removing gender marker on birth certificates


Pennsylvania Democrats are seeking to remove the gender marker from state-issued birth certificates. The aim of the move is to reportedly “protect individual privacy” and “prevent discrimination”. The initiative is unlikely to become law as the state’s legislature is dominated by Republicans.
On January 13, State Senators Timothy P. Kearney, Amanda M. Cappelletti, Katie J. Muth, and Lindsey M. Williams released a joint memo calling on other state senators to co-sponsor their legislation.
“...there are still tremendous hurdles when it comes to the overall process for individuals to change their name and change their sex, particularly on birth certificates,” the state senators write in the memo. “By removing sex designations entirely, we can remove the barriers of acquiring gender-affirming birth certificates.”
The memo draws a parallel with elimination of race markers on older birth certificates, which “had historically been used as a part of systemic discrimination.” The state senators note that non-binary individuals continue to face discrimination due to not having gender-affirming documentation and concede that while their proposal will not fix the discrimination these individuals face, it will remove at least one obstacle.
The administration of Pennsylvania Governor Tom Wolf previously introduced a “Sex/Gender Designation Statement” on state driver’s license/ID card applications which allows individuals to choose one of three genders to show on their licenses or ID cards: male, female, or non-binary/other.
